在wordpress的登录小工具中,如果只想保留管理站点与登录链接,而不想要其它的什么RSS和wordpress官网链接,可以参考以下方法。

在wordpress目录 /wp-includes/widgets/中,找到class-wp-widget-meta.php文件,在其中寻找以下代码:

<?php wp_register(); ?>
	<li><?php wp_loginout(); ?></li>
	<li><a href="<?php echo esc_url( get_bloginfo( 'rss2_url' ) ); ?>"><?php _e( 'Entries <abbr title="Really Simple Syndication">RSS</abbr>' ); ?></a></li>
	<li><a href="<?php echo esc_url( get_bloginfo( 'comments_rss2_url' ) ); ?>"><?php _e( 'Comments <abbr title="Really Simple Syndication">RSS</abbr>' ); ?></a></li>
<?php

其中,共有三行<li>,如果第二行与第三行被注释掉了,RSS链接就被注释掉了。如果同时需要去掉wordpress官网链接信息,则在此文件中寻找以下代码:

echo apply_filters(
// 'widget_meta_poweredby',
	sprintf(
		'<li><a href="%s" title="%s">%s</a></li>',
		esc_url( __( 'https://wordpress.org/' ) ),
		esc_attr__( 'Powered by WordPress, state-of-the-art semantic personal publishing platform.' ),
		_x( 'WordPress.org', 'meta widget link text' )
	),
	$instance
);

如果此代码被注释掉了,wordpress的官网链接信息也从登录小工具中同时消失。

转载请注明来自 LiZhenyu.Com五百年
本文地址:http://www.lizhenyu.com/modify-or-delete-rss-links-in-wordpress-login-widgets.html
分类: 代码